Sacred Himalayan Butter Lamps: Light Offerings for Altar & Meditation Practice
The Butter Lamp (Marme in Tibetan) is among the most cherished and frequently practiced devotional offerings in all of Tibetan Buddhism. Light is understood as the natural antidote to darkness, just as wisdom is the natural antidote to ignorance; lighting a butter lamp before the Buddha, Bodhisattvas, and protective deities is therefore both a literal and symbolic act of dispelling confusion and illuminating the mind. The practice carries deep merit-generating significance: each lamp lit is dedicated to the welfare and awakening of all sentient beings, and the unwavering, steady quality of the flame is itself held up as an image of stable, one-pointed concentration in meditation.
